Преобразователь угла поворота вала в код Советский патент 1986 года по МПК H03M1/28 

Описание патента на изобретение SU1280698A1

Изобретение относится к автоматике и вычислительной технике и может быть использовано для связи аналоговых источников информации с цифровьм вычислительным устройством.

Цель изобретения - повышение точности, быстродействия и расширение функциональных возможностей преобразователя угла поворота вала в код.

На фиг. 1 изображена структурная схема предлагаемого преобразователя; на фиг. 2 - структурная схема формирователя кода октантов; на фиг. 3 - временная диаграмма работы преобразователя.

Преобразователь угла поворота.вал в код содержит формирователь 1 переменного напряжения, синусно-косинус- ный вращающийся трансформатор (СКВТ) 2, блок 3 одновибраторов J состоящий из двух последовательно соединенных одновибраторов, регистр 4 последовательного приближения, формирователь 5 кода октантов, первый 6 и второй 7 вьтрямители, блок 8 инверторов, блок

9элементов ИСКЛЮЧАЮЩЕЕ ИЛИ, первый

10и второй 11 блоки памяти, коммутатор 12, первый 13 и второй 14 диф- роаналоговые преобразователи (ЦАП), первый 15 и второй 16 компараторы,

первый 17, второй 18 и третий 19 регистры.

Формирователь 1 переменного напряжения содержит последовательно соединенные генератор 20 импульсов, де- литель 21 частоты и усилитель 22 мощности.

Коммутатор 12 содержит инвертор 23, первый 24 и второй 25 блоки элементов И-ИЛИ.

Формирователь 5 кода октантов содержит первый 26 и второй 27 компараторы, первый 28, второй 29, третий 30 и четвертьй 31 элементы ИСКЛЮЧАЮЩЕЕ ИЛИ.

Усилитель 22 мощности может быть вьтолнен на двух переключателях по мостовой схеме, в диагональ которой включена первичная обмотка СКВТ 2. Управление переключателями производится выходными сигналами делителя 2 частоты.

Преобразователь угла поворота вала в код работает следующим образом.

Генератор 20 вырабатьгоает тактовы импульсы (фиг. За). В делителе 21 формируются прямоугольные импульсы скважностью 2 с частотой напряжения

питания СКВТ 2, которые усиливаются по мощности в усилителе 22 (фиг. Зб). На выходе СКВТ 2 формируются прямоугольные импульсы (фиг. Зв), промоду- лированные по амплитуде в функции синуса и косинуса угла 9 поворота вала СКВТ 2. Выпрямители 6 и 7 осуществляют двухполупериодное выпрямление выходных сигналов СКВТ 2 (фиг. Зг и Зд, Одновременно к омпа- раторы 26 и 27 формирователя 5 вырабатывают единичные сигналы, соответствующие положительным полупериодам выходных напряжений СКВТ 2.

На выходах элементов ИСКЛЮЧАЮЩЕЕ ИЛИ 28, 30 и 31 формируются логические сигналы, соответствующие значениям первого, второго и третьего разрядов кода угла 0 (код октанта), причем значение первого (старшего) разряда совпадает со знаком функции sin6, а на выходе элемента ИСКЛЮЧАЮЩЕЕ ИЛИ 29 формируется логический сигнал, соответствующий знаку функции cosS, т.е.

Uj8 Us,

U -U e-Ujg

и,, -и,,

из. и.

и

io

5

Значения логических сигналов в диапазоне О - 2 при единичном и нулевом выходных сигналах делителя 21 приведены в таблице.

Выходные напряжения выпрямителей 6 и 7 сравниваются на компараторе 16, в результате чего на его выходе фор-j мируется логический сигнал, принимающий следующее значение:

и,б 0, если , ; U,, 1 , если

и.

и,б-1

0

если ; б и .

Первый одновибратор блока 3

запускается по фронту сигнала на каждом полупериоде выходного напряжения делителя 21 частоты. На выходе блока 3 одновибраторов через время t ,, , рав5 ное времени нарастания выходных напряжений СКВТ 2 до установившегося значения, формируется импульс отрицательной полярности (фиг. Зё).

В регистре 4 обеспечивается режим

0 поразрядных уравновешиваний.. Цифровые выходы регистра 4 подключены к входам блока 11 памяти непосредственно и через блок 8 инверторов - к входу блока 10 памяти. В блоках 10

5 и 11 записаны,табличные значения функции sin от О до Y7/2 и от /2 до 1 при изменении входного кода от нулевого до максимального значения (например, БИС К505РЕЗ 0068-0071).

При этом на выходах блоков 10 и 11 формируются коды co3N и sinN в пределах первого октанта.

В первом, четвертом, пятом и восьмом октантах на выход блока 25 проходит код с выхода блока 11 памяти, а на выход блока 24 - код с выхода блока 10 и наоборот, во втором, третьем, шестом и седьмом октантах на Выход блока 25 проходит код с выхода Ьлока 10, а на выход блока 24 - код с выхода блока И, т.е.:

W,,,.sinN, N cosN в первом.

25 четвертом, пятом и восьмом октантах;

N-J cosN, N sinN во втором, третьем, шестом и седьмом октантах.

На выходах ЦАП 14 и 13 формируются аналоговые сигналы, равные произведению сигналов на их цифровых и аналоговых входах.

На выходе компаратора 13 формируется сигнал, пропорциональный разности выходных напряжений ЦАП 13 и14

Полученное рассогласование сводится к нулю по методу поразрядных уравновешиваний в регистре 4, который запускается на каждом полупериоде сигнала делителя 21. Поразрядные уравновешивания осуществляются на интервале A t, когда выходные сигналы СКВТ 2 остаются неизменными во времени. Каждый цикл преобразования состоит из m тактов (фиг. Зж и Зз). По окончании последнего такта на циклическом выходе регистра 4 формируется нулевой логический уровень (фиг. Зи) При этом код N на выходе регистра 4 связан с модулем синуса и косинуса sinYHsinQl, coslf lcoB91 соотношением f

в первом, четвертом, пятом и восьмом октантах;

N « /2- во втором, третьем, шее-- том и седьмом октантах.

Выражение для 0 можно записать в следующем виде:

9 5i /4 (п-1 )+N в нечетных октанта

& Я /4 (п-1 )+N в четных октантах; где N - инверсное значение выходного кода регистра 4 определяемое выражением N A /4-N.

Код с выхода регистра 4 поступает на вход блока 9, другой вход которого управляет третьим разрядом кода угла. При этом на выход блока 9 в нечетных октантах проходит прямой код

N, а четных октантах - инверсный код N. Код угла с выхода блока 9 совместно с кодом октантов представляют код угла в в диапазоне О - 2. На выходах блоков 25 и 24 формируются коды модулей синуса и косинуса угла S

N„5 sin)f lsin9l, N cosy lcosei .

5

0

0

5

0

Коды модулей и знаки функций sin6 и COS0, а также код угла ft записываются в регистры 19, 18 и 17 по отрицательному фронту импульса с циклического выхода регистра 4,

Расширение функциональных возможностей преобразователя за счет получения кодов синуса и косинуса угла вполне обосновано при использовании подобных устройств, например, для формирования развертывающих напряжений электронно-лучевой трубки, которые формируются путем перемножения кодов синуса и косинуса с пилообразным напряжением, прикладываемым к аналоговым входам умножающих ЦАП.

Поскольку преобразователь включается на каждом полупериоде изменения напряжения питания СКВТ 2, быстродействие его при одинаковой частоте напряжения питания повьшхается в два раза. За счет параллельного формирования трех старших разрядов кода угла достигается сокращение длительности цикла преобразования.

Статическая погрешность преобразователя обусловлена в основном погрешностью ЦАП 13 и 14 и выпрямителей 6 и 7.

Поскольку в преобразователе исключены блоки выборки - хранения, то и исключены их инструментальные погрешности, которые больше погрешностей выпрямителей.

45 Формула изобретения

1. Преобразователь угла поворота вала в код, содержащий формирователь переменного напряжения, первьш и второй выходы которого подключены к входам синусно-косинусного вращающегося трансформатора, блок одновибраторов, регистр последовательного приближения, группа выходов которого через блок инверторов подключена к входам первого блока памяти, второй блок па мяти, первый и второй цифроаналого- вые преобразователи, выходы которых подключены к входам первого компара.тора, выход первого компаратора подключен к информационному входу регистра последовательного приближения, отличающийся тем, что, с целью повышения точности, быстродействия и расширения функциональных возможностей преобразователя, в него введены первый и второй выпрямители, формирователь кода октантов, коммутаторj второй компаратор, блок элементов ИСКЛЮЧАЮЩЕЕ ИЛИ, первый, второй и третий регистры, первый и второй выходы синусно-кисинусного вращающегося трансформатора подключены к входам первого и второго выпрямителей соответственно и к первому и второму входам формирователя кода октантов, третий вход которого соединен с третьим выходом формирователя переменного напряжения, четвертый вход - с выходом второго компаратора, а первый, второй и третий выходы подключены к входам старших разрядов первого регистра, выходы первого и второго выпрямителей подключены к аналоговым входам первого и второго цифроаналоговых преобразователей соответственно и к входам второго компаратора, выход которого подключен к управляющему входу коммутатора, первая и вторая группы информационных входов коммутатора соединены соответственно с выходами первого и второго блоков памяти, первая группа входов коммутатора подключена к цифровым входам первого цифро- аналогового преобразователя и к группе входов второго регистра, вторая группа выходов коммутатора подключена к цифровым входам второго цифро- аналогового преобразователя и к группе входов третьего регистра, группа выходов регистра последовательного приближения подключена к входам второго блока памяти и к информационным входам блока элементов ИСКЛЮЧАЮЩЕЕ ИЛИ, выходы которого подключены к входам младших разрядов первого регистра, первый, третий и четвертый выходы формирователя кода октантов подключены соответственно к знаковому разряду третьего регистра, к управляющему входу блока элементов ИСКЛЮЧАЮЩЕЕ ИЛИ и к знаковому разряду второго регистра, третий выход формирователя переменного напряжения подключен к входу блока одновибрато- ров, выход которого и четвертый выход формирователя переменного напряжения подключены соответственно к установочному и тактовому входам регистра последовательного приближения, выход которого подключен к синхрони- зирующим входам первого, второго и третьего регистров,

2,Преобразователь по п. 1, о т - личающийся тем, что формирователь переменного напряжения содержит последовательно соединенные генератор импульсов, делитель частоты и усилитель мощности, выходы которого являются первым и вторым выходами формирователя .переменного

5 напряжения, третьим и четвертым выходами которого являются соответственно выходы делителя частоты и генератора импульсов,

3,Преобразователь по п, 1, о т- 0 личающийся тем, что коммутатор содержит инвертор, первый и второй блоки элементов И-ИЛИ, каждый из которых содержит первый и второй управляющие входы и первую и вторую

группы информационных входов, вход инвертора является управляющим входом коммутатора и подключен к первым управляющим входам первого и второго блока элементов И-ИЛИ, а вы- ход инвертора подключен к вторым управляющим входам первого и второго блока элементов И-ИЛИ, первая группа информационных входов второго блока элементов И-ИЛИ соединена с второй 5 группой информационных входов первого блока элемента И-ИЛИ и является первой группой информационных входов коммутатора, первая группа информационных входов первого блока элемен- 40 тов И-ИЛИ соединена с второй группой информационных входов второго блока элементов И-ИЛИ и является второй группой информационных входов коммутатора, а выходы первого и второго 45 блоков элементов И-ИЛИ являются соответственно, первой и второй группой выходов коммутатора, 1

4. Преобразователь по п, 1, о т - 20 личающийся тем, что формирователь кода октантов содержит первый и второй компараторы, первый, второй, третий и четвертый элементы ИСКЛЮЧАЮЩЕЕ ИЛИ, первые входы перво- сс- го и второго компараторов являются соответственно, первым и вторым вхо- дами формирователя кода октантов, вторые входы первого и второго компараторов подключены к общей шине.

а выходы первого и второго компараторов подключены к одним входам первого и йторого элементов ИСКЛЮЧАЩЕЕ ИЛИ, другие входы которых объединены и являются третьим входом формирователя , а выходы подключены к входам третьего элемента ИСКЛЮЧАЮЩЕЕ ИЛИ, выход которого подключен к од06988

ному входу четвертого элемента ИСКЛЮЧАЮЩЕЕ ИЛИ, другой вход которого является четвертым входом формирователя, выходы первого, третьего, чет- .5 вертого, второго элементов ИСКЛЮЧАЮЩЕЕ ИЛИ являются соответственно, первым, вторым, третьим и четвертым выходами формирователя кода октантов.

Похожие патенты SU1280698A1

название год авторы номер документа
Многоканальный преобразователь угла поворота вала в код 1983
  • Богданов Владимир Дмитриевич
SU1120383A1
Следящий преобразователь угла поворота вала в код 1983
  • Богданов Владимир Дмитриевич
  • Кудряшов Борис Александрович
  • Смирнов Юрий Сергеевич
SU1116446A1
Преобразователь угла поворота вала в код 1984
  • Теплицкий Владимир Львович
SU1231610A1
Преобразователь угла поворота вала с контролем выходного кода 1986
  • Шишков Алексей Борисович
SU1334373A2
Преобразователь угла поворота вала в код 1988
  • Смирнов Юрий Сергеевич
SU1690198A2
Функциональный преобразователь угла поворота вала в код 1984
  • Кудряшов Борис Александрович
  • Смирнов Юрий Сергеевич
  • Шишков Алексей Борисович
SU1262728A1
Двухотсчетный преобразователь угла поворота вала в код 1985
  • Богданов Владимир Дмитриевич
  • Смирнов Юрий Сергеевич
SU1269265A1
Преобразователь угла поворота вала в код с самоконтролем 1987
  • Шишков Алексей Борисович
SU1462484A1
Преобразователь угла поворота вала в код 1986
  • Шишков Алексей Борисович
SU1365353A2
Устройство для управления шаговым электродвигателем 1987
  • Смирнов Юрий Сергеевич
SU1520647A1

Иллюстрации к изобретению SU 1 280 698 A1

Реферат патента 1986 года Преобразователь угла поворота вала в код

Изобретение относится к области автоматики и вычислительной техники и может быть использовано для связи аналоговых источников информации с цифровым вычислительным устройством. С целью повьш1ения точности, быстродействия и расширения функциональных -возможностей в преобразователь угла поворота вала в код, содержащий формирователь 1 переменного напряжения, синусно-косинусный. вращающийся транс- форматор 2 (СКВТ), блок 3 одновибра- тора, регистр 4 последовательного приближения (РПП), первый 10 и второй II блоки памяти, первый 13 и второй 14 цифроаналоговые преобразователи (ЦАП), первый компаратор 15, введены первый 6 и второй 7 выпрямители, формирователь 5 кода октантов, коммутатор 12, второй компаратор 1б, блок 9 элементов ИСКЛЮЧАЮЩЕЕ РШИ, первый 17, второй 18 и третий 19 регистры. Прямоугольные сигналы с выхода формирователя I переменного напряжения поступают в первичную обмотку СКВТ. Выходные напряжения СКВТ приводятся в первый квадрант двумя двухполупериодными выпрямителями 6, 7, выходные напряжения которых перемножаются на двух ЦАП 13, 14 с кодами модулей синуса и косинуса, получаемых путем распространения октант- ных функций, записанных в двух блоках памяти 10, II на угол, приведенный в первый квадрант. Разность между выходными напряжениями двух ПАП сводится к нулю в РПП 4, который запускается на каждом полупериоде напряжения питания СКВТ. Выходной код РПП при помощи блока элементов ИСЮЖ)- ЧАЮЩЕЕ ИЛИ, управляемого младшим разрядом кода октантов, преобразуется в код угла СКВТ в пределах первого октанта. Знаки синуса и косинуса выявляются на компараторах, а код октантов формируется по знакам и соот ношению модулей синуса и косинуса. 3 з.п. ф-лы, 3 ил. S (Л IND 00 00

Формула изобретения SU 1 280 698 A1

Г Л

fui.Z

Редактор А, Ренин

Составитель А. Смирнов Техред В.Кадар

Заказ 7133/58 Тираж 816Подписное

ВНИИПИ Государственного комитета СССР

по делам изобретений и открытий 113035, Москва, Ж-35, Раушская наб., д. 4/5

Производственно-полиграфическое предприятие, г, Ужгород, ул. Проектная, А

Фиг.5

Корректор Е. Ропко

Документы, цитированные в отчете о поиске Патент 1986 года SU1280698A1

Следящий преобразователь угла поворота вала в код 1983
  • Богданов Владимир Дмитриевич
  • Кудряшов Борис Александрович
  • Смирнов Юрий Сергеевич
SU1116446A1
Топка с несколькими решетками для твердого топлива 1918
  • Арбатский И.В.
SU8A1
Домрачев В
Г
и др
Преобразователь сигналов вращающегося трансформатора в код угла последовательного приближения - Измерительная техника, 1984, № 8, с
Способ использования делительного аппарата ровничных (чесальных) машин, предназначенных для мериносовой шерсти, с целью переработки на них грубых шерстей 1921
  • Меньщиков В.Е.
SU18A1
I.

SU 1 280 698 A1

Авторы

Смирнов Юрий Сергеевич

Шишков Алексей Борисович

Даты

1986-12-30Публикация

1985-08-27Подача